How they compare

Colombia currently reports 16.36 terawatt-hours against 10.38 terawatt-hours in United Kingdom, a difference of 5.98 terawatt-hours.

That makes Colombia's figure about 1.6 times United Kingdom's.

The two have swapped places 24 times across 60 shared years of data; in 1966 it was Colombia ahead.

Colombia ranks 9th and United Kingdom ranks 12th of 80 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Colombia averaged higher in 3 and United Kingdom in 4.

Head to head by decade

Decade Colombia United Kingdom Difference Ahead
1960s 0.4735 terawatt-hours -0.339 terawatt-hours 0.8125 terawatt-hours Colombia
1970s 0.8476 terawatt-hours 0.1047 terawatt-hours 0.7429 terawatt-hours Colombia
1980s 1.37 terawatt-hours 0.0474 terawatt-hours 1.32 terawatt-hours Colombia
1990s 0.7473 terawatt-hours 1.18 terawatt-hours 0.4327 terawatt-hours United Kingdom
2000s 1.26 terawatt-hours 3.1 terawatt-hours 1.85 terawatt-hours United Kingdom
2010s 2.27 terawatt-hours 16.86 terawatt-hours 14.59 terawatt-hours United Kingdom
2020s 3.63 terawatt-hours 7.39 terawatt-hours 3.76 terawatt-hours United Kingdom

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
